Output 43bce110cfd58b36929f223137b16fee4105b5830dc7e8bb22a121362db85520:1

value
169151009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 842b1e35ee8cc2985ba92f88ece98ab124d11204 OP_EQUAL
address
3DjrmksfLEG9UVPnAwAfJLWidS1ndgB3wv
transaction
43bce110cfd58b36929f223137b16fee4105b5830dc7e8bb22a121362db85520
spent
true